Having Pain In Large Intestine, Increased Bowel Movement, Blood In Stool. Have Hemorrhoids. How To Overcome This?

I've been having pain in my large intestine. It seems like it's all over the intestine. It's anywhere from aching, burning, or little shooting pains. I've noticed my bowel movements have increased from one a day to about two or three. Also, my stools had a little bright red blood in them yesterday (once in am) and the today(once in afternoon). I have internal hemmroids so I'm thinking thats what that is but not sure about the intesting feelings. This all seemed to happen after I had pelvic massage and was also drinking a lot of orangejuice and eating oranges as well as drinking vinegar water.

Getting pelvic massage and consumption of citrus foods like oranges is definitely good.
I can assure you they are not the cause of your symptoms. Increased bowel frequency and blood in stool I would like to consider the possibility of Dysentery. Presentation of internal hemorrhoid is painless bright red bleeding, they usually don't affect the frequency of stools.

Would suggest you to visit your local physician for confirmation of diagnosis.
